We are Batch LDN. A made-to-order clothing brand rewriting the way we consume fashion. Our collections are exclusively manufactured using our ‘Batch Model’. A handmade-to-order method that produces only what’s necessary.

It’s a simple premise, if you only make exactly what you need, you cut out all of the waste and overproduction. A slower, more conscious method of manufacture.

As we don’t have to account for the normal fashion mark-up - it allows us to sell high end luxury pieces, at prices you can justify.

Our garments are designed with versatility at the core, being as easy to dress up as they are to dress down. Solving the “what to wear when you want to look good conundrum”.

Think of Batch as the backbone of your wardrobe. The forever favourites. Luxurious, versatile pieces that are fitting for all the big occasions in life.
